Vrancart SA 2019 SR

The report highlights Vrancart Group's sustainability performance for 2019, focusing on its role as a major recycler of cellulose fiber-based materials in Romania. Key achievements include using 93.5% recyclable raw materials in production and maintaining an integrated management system certified to ISO 9001, 14001, and OHSAS 18001. The group reported a net profit of RON 23.2 million and employed 1,316 people. Environmental efforts focused on waste management and reducing CO2 emissions, which totaled 25,938 tons for the Adjud facility. Social initiatives included supporting local education and healthcare in Adjud.
